New Day VA Loan
A New Day VA loan is a type of mortgage loan that is available to veterans and active-duty military members. These loans are backed by the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A), which means that they come with a number of benefits, including no down payment requirement, no private mortgage insurance (PMI), and competitive interest rates.
- No down payment required: This is a major benefit of New Day VA loans, as it can save veterans and military members thousands of dollars.
- No private mortgage insurance (PMI): PMI is a type of insurance that is required by most lenders on loans where the down payment is less than 20%. PMI can add hundreds of dollars to your monthly mortgage payment.
- Competitive interest rates: New Day VA loans typically have lower interest rates than conventional mortgages. This can save veterans and military members money on their monthly mortgage payments.
- No prepayment penalty: This means that you can pay off your New Day VA loan early without having to pay a fee.
- Assumable: New Day VA loans can be assumed by another veteran or active-duty military member. This can be a great way to help a fellow veteran or military member get into a home.
- Available for a variety of properties: New Day VA loans can be used to purchase a variety of properties, including single-family homes, condos, and townhouses.
- Can be used for refinancing: New Day VA loans can also be used to refinance an existing mortgage. This can help veterans and military members lower their monthly mortgage payments or get a lower interest rate.

Tips for Getting a New Day VA Loan
New Day VA loans are a great option for veterans and active-duty military members who are looking to buy a home. They offer a number of advantages over traditional mortgages, including no down payment requirement, no private mortgage insurance (PMI), and competitive interest rates.
Here are five tips for getting a New Day VA loan:
Tip 1: Check your eligibility.
The first step is to check your eligibility for a New Day VA loan. To be eligible, you must be a veteran or an active-duty military member. You must also have a valid Certificate of Eligibility (COE) from the VA.
Tip 2: Get pre-approved.
Getting pre-approved for a New Day VA loan is a good way to show sellers that you are a serious buyer. It also allows you to shop around for the best interest rate.
Tip 3: Find a VA-approved lender.
Not all lenders are approved to offer New Day VA loans. When choosing a lender, be sure to ask if they are VA-approved.
Tip 4: Gather your documents.
You will need to provide the lender with a number of documents, including your Certificate of Eligibility (COE), your income and asset information, and your credit report.
Tip 5: Be patient.
The VA loan process can take some time. Be patient and work closely with your lender to get through the process as quickly as possible.
